Natural Product Identification
Common NameActinoallolide E
Provided ByNPAtlasNPAtlas Logo
Description Actinoallolide E is found in Actinoallomurus.
Structure
Thumb
SynonymsNot Available
Chemical FormulaC32H50O7
Average Mass546.7450 Da
Monoisotopic Mass546.35565 Da
IUPAC Name(5R,6S,7R,9Z,12R)-14-ethyl-7-hydroxy-5-[(2R,4E,6S,7S)-7-hydroxy-4,6,8-trimethyl-9-oxoundec-4-en-2-yl]-6,10,12-trimethyl-4,15-dioxabicyclo[10.2.1]pentadeca-1(14),9-diene-3,13-dione
